Reign Maximinus
Person (obv.) Maximinus (Augustus)
Obverse inscription ΑΥΤ Κ Γ Ι ΟΥΗ ΜΑΞΙΜΕΙΝΟϹ
Edition Αὐτοκράτωρ Καῖσαρ Γάϊος Ἰούλιος Οὐῆρος Μαξιμεῖνος Αὐτ(οκράτωρ) Κ(αῖσαρ) Γ(άϊος) Ἰ(ούλιος) Οὐῆ(ρος) Μαξιμεῖνος
Translation Emperor Caesar Gaius Julius Verus Maximinus
Obverse design laureate, draped and cuirassed bust of Maximinus, right, seen from rear
Reverse inscription ΕΦΕϹΙΩΝ Γ ΝΕΩΚΟΡΩΝ
Edition Ἐφεσίων γʹ νεωκόρων Ἐφεσίων γʹ νεωκόρων
Translation of the Ephesians, thrice neocorate
Reverse design Artemis advancing, right, seizing stag by the antlers, right, and placing knee on its back
Metal copper-based alloy
Average diameter 22 mm
Average weight 4.85 g
Axis 6
Reference Karwiese 817–8
Specimens 4 (2 in the core collections)
